GIRLS END OF SUMMER SHOWCASE

This showcase allows players ages 14-17 a chance to show their talent AND work-ethic to college coaches in a practice setting. Players will go through a college-simulated practice session, followed by competitions and games. Practice drills will be taken from top college programs and will be facilitated by former college coaches and players. This unique opportunity will allow you to be in front of coaches in a practice setting, allowing them to project you into their system.

Name: RJ Cole

Position: Guard

AAU Team: F.A.C.E.S.

Summary of Game: RJ Cole, MVP of the 11u division in the inagural "Best of the Best" event, played with much more poise and compusure than his 9-year old age warrents.  The lefty handles the ball, sees the floor and can shoot from beyond the arc.  We look forward to watching his development of RJ in the coming years.
